Lees-91探花 attends HOSA conference, announces scholarship
By Hayden Moses ’16
91探花 representatives attended the North Carolina Health Occupations Students of America (NCHOSA) conference to interact with more than 2,400 prospective students and educators by raising awareness about nursing and health science opportunities at 91探花. In addition to recruiting, Lees-91探花 attended as a diamond sponsor, the only institution of higher education to make such a presence at the conference. The conference was held in Greensboro, N.C. in late March.
Nicole Chappell, instructor of nursing and health sciences, commented, “It was exciting to be surrounded by such a large group of young individuals so passionate about the allied health fields. I feel certain Lees-91探花 will have the pleasure of teaching some of these up and coming nurses and pre-med students in the near future.”
The team informed prospective students about the 91探花 HOSA Scholarship, an annual, renewable $2,000 scholarship awarded to one high school senior who is an active member of HOSA and plans to work toward a degree in nursing or applied health at Lees-91探花. The winner must maintain an average GPA of 3.25 or higher.
